Sample/Background Post:
He wished he could do something about the unbearable heat, but that would draw too much attention to himself. Instead he settled for chilling the bottle of water that he had tucked between his knees while he waited for the bus to arrive. Sylar glanced at the horizon, watching the mirage shimmer on the horizon, and let out a bitter laugh. He'd never been to hell, but he was pretty sure that it was next door to Texas.
"Why would anyone want to live here?" He said as he rubbed the cold bottle against his forehead.
The old woman frowned at him. She was dried up, her face looked like the forgotten potato in the bottom refrigerator. The one that smelled bad, but you couldn't find because it was hiding under an onion. "What's you problem?"
